Identify the property that justifies the statement.

∠ XYZ≌ ∠ PDQ and ∠ PDQ≌ ∠ ABC , so ∠ XYZ≌ ∠ ABC.
a. Add. Prop. of ≅
b. Reflex. Prop. of ≅
c. Trans. Prop. of ≅
d. Sym. Prop. of ≅

Final answer:

The correct property justifying that angle XYZ is congruent to angle ABC through a common congruent angle PDQ is the Transitive Property of Congruence.

Step-by-step explanation:

The question is asking to identify the property that justifies the statement that if angle XYZ is congruent to angle PDQ, and angle PDQ is congruent to angle ABC, then angle XYZ is congruent to angle ABC. This relationship can be justified by the Transitive Property of Congruence, which allows us to infer that if two angles are each congruent to a third one, then they are congruent to each other.

The transitive property can be applied to geometric figures, algebraic expressions, inequalities, or in various logical arguments to establish such relationships. It is one of the fundamental properties used across different branches of mathematics to make valid deductions and inferences.
